THE BATTLE AXE: A Partnership? (11/05/2012)—Curiously, what appears to mankind as a bitter conflict between GOD and Satan does not emerge so much from anger and malice as from insurmountable disparities between corruption and divine intent, sacred person and created being, or self-will and divine will. It has more to do with imperatives of being and existence than choice and volition. Thus, relative to mankind, Satan and his followers function as having no other purpose than to exercise authority and power in heaven and earth. Relative to Almighty GOD, the limits upon the angels may be spoken of as ignorance, lack of understanding, and simplicity. Through the exaggeration of self-will, what would otherwise appear as innocence becomes seen, instead, as deliberate disobedience, iniquity and rebellion. Christ and his church are to be a demonstration from the earth even to those of the heaven, and a more complete revealing of divine love, holiness, and sovereign majesty (Ephesians 3: 10-12, KJV). The partnership to recover both heaven and earth from sin—we may say “the series of covenants”—is not with Satan; the partnership is with mankind, and is directed to eternal life, forgiveness, repentance and salvation, rather to than punishment.

      Believers in Jesus Christ “see with new eyes” where they consistently apply the frameworks and truths from the Gospel to recognize, understand and value experience and spiritual truth. When the Gospel is used to provide definition and meaning in making life choices and decisions, the foundations of logic and reason shift to maintain clarity and consistency for the things given to mankind through GOD incarnate as Jesus. The Gospel along with the full content of Scripture determines ones perspective, and resolves all questions regarding whether events and ideas are canonical/apocryphal, good/bad, false/true, holy/unholy, real/unreal, right/wrong and righteous/unrighteous.

      Believers come to know GOD as their human nature is transformed, as their sacred knowledge is expanded, and as they take on divine attitudes, goals, purposes and perspective. The conscience, mind and self-will of those who submit to the influence of Jesus are cleansed, purified and revived. The endowment of divine substance imparted at Creation is increased through the imparted, indwelling spirit, the Holy Ghost. Thereby, mankind becomes capable of operating through sacred proclamation, promise, and prophecy that speak to things that have been, are now, and are yet to unfold. (See Isaiah 42: 5-9, Isaiah 43: 18-20, King James Version).

      The old idea of an alliance between GOD and the devil to punish sinners, and more on spiritual seeking and being spiritually sought are examined, today. The “Yahoo! Answers” writer using the ID “Charles” (Level 2 with 265 points, a member since September 10, 2012) posted the following:

Christians, is the devil allies with God since the devil is still going to punish the sinners in hell too?

THE BATTLE AXE: Seeking and Being Sought (11/04/2012)—There are many features of the earth that prevent the exercise of dominion by any created being or living creature apart from Almighty GOD. Divine process within the earth goes forward through frameworks of time and space. Life for mankind, therefore, is not continuous, and goes forward by activity that does not endure, and that is by episodes, discrete events, and occurrences with frequent interruptions. Various limitations identify mankind including frailty (that bones break), mortality, muscular exhaustion that demands rest and refreshing, the cycle of sleeping and waking along with disease and sickness. What we call “sovereign rule” by GOD, in fact, is the imparting of life, awareness, and both actual and potential being. All things that exist do not also have life; the living are endowed with spirit content that appears through such features as consciousness, person, and self-will. The operation of the imparted, indwelling Spirit is the government by Almighty GOD that generates (1) obedience to divine law (2) acknowledgment and worship (3) expression of divine person within and by the created as well as (4) union and a continuing bond to the Creator. Saying this another way: One exists only as an emanation from divine will, and the sacred person of GOD. Those living in the earth need make no search for GOD as if he is lost, and must be recovered. Men need only function, fulfill their purpose, complete their mortality, and correctly occupy their given place in divine order. What men are forced to seek is assurance, certainty and confidence in what is otherwise invisible and unknowable to themselves. Mankind must embrace the continuous revelation of GOD through activity, behavior, commitment, experience, social interaction, and spiritual purification.

      Mature believers who have had to answer this question for the sake of their own faith and understanding generally agree the Lord wants them and his church to share the following:

      The Devil is not now or ever will be an independent being who rules over mankind in the heaven, in the earth, under the earth, or in the seas. While the beginnings of the Adversary (as he is called) were as a prince and ruler in heaven, he has lost authority, estate, and legitimate place there through sin. The devil continues as a finite being, who is not endowed with either mortality or immortality. More than this, he and those who support and surround him are not endowed with all knowledge, with the human ability to increase knowledge by growing and learning through experience, or with the ability to foresee and create the future. The full measure of knowledge they would use throughout their functioning and service was supplied to them at their creation; and in that sense, the angels are complete, finished and sealed.

      The angels were not given a knowledge of sin, or an ability to repent from sin through the operation of an imparted, indwelling spirit from GOD as we see granted to mankind by the ministries of Jesus Christ. The angels all continue to have their being as a dispensation of GOD. The holy scriptures do not describe the angels as having any agenda to interact with mankind except at the direct command of GOD. Their legitimate service includes visitation as divine messengers as well appearing as destroyers who enforce sacred law and divine judgment against sin. Heavenly beings in rebellion against the divine will for mankind generally do so through the manipulation of humans promoting corruption, deceit, disobedience, fear, ignorance, lies, unbelief, and violence.
